U.K.'s Fox Acknowledges Hard to Strike EU Trade Deal by 2019
- Trade secretary is in Washington working toward deal with U.S.
- Says chlorine-washed chicken only a detail in future accord

Trade Secretary Liam Fox acknowledged it will be a stretch for Britain to negotiate a new trading relationship with the European Union by the time of their 2019 divorce in another sign that the U.K. government will seek a post-Brexit transitional period.
